Accounting Visa Sponsorship Jobs in Virginia
Virginia's accounting sector offers strong visa sponsorship opportunities, particularly around Northern Virginia's government contracting hub and Richmond's financial services center. Major employers like Deloitte, PwC, KPMG, and EY maintain significant presences in McLean, Arlington, and Richmond, while defense contractors in the DC metro area frequently sponsor H-1B visas for specialized accounting roles.

Which accounting companies sponsor visas in Virginia?
Major accounting firms with strong Virginia presence include the Big Four (Deloitte, PwC, EY, KPMG) based in McLean and Arlington, plus BDO and Grant Thornton in Richmond. Defense contractors like Booz Allen Hamilton, CACI, and SAIC also sponsor accounting professionals for government contract compliance roles. Regional firms like Cherry Bekaert and Yount, Hyde & Barbour provide additional sponsorship opportunities across the state.
Which visa types are most common for accounting roles in Virginia?
H-1B visas dominate Virginia accounting sponsorship, especially for CPA-track positions and specialized roles like forensic accounting or government contract auditing. Some firms sponsor TN visas for Canadian and Mexican nationals in senior accounting positions. L-1 visa transfers are common when international accounting firms move employees to their Virginia offices, particularly in the Northern Virginia corridor.

Which cities in Virginia have the most accounting sponsorship jobs?
McLean and Arlington lead with the highest concentration due to Big Four presence and proximity to federal agencies. Richmond follows with corporate headquarters and regional accounting firms. Norfolk offers maritime and military contractor opportunities, while Virginia Beach has growing financial services. Tysons Corner and Reston also provide significant opportunities in the Northern Virginia technology corridor.
What are the prevailing wage considerations for accounting roles in Virginia?
Northern Virginia typically commands higher prevailing wages due to federal contractor requirements and cost of living, particularly in Fairfax and Arlington counties. Richmond and Norfolk areas have more moderate wage levels but still meet H-1B requirements for most CPA and senior accounting positions. Government security clearance eligibility can significantly increase wage levels and sponsorship likelihood across all Virginia markets.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ored accounting jobs in Virginia?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
